A drive to Port Klang took us to Choon Guan Hainan Coffee 1956. As the name suggests, they have been around since 1956 and offer traditional Hainanese kopitiam favourites like kopi, chicken rice and chicken chop.

We ordered the Chicken Chop (RM21.90) and the Hainanese Chicken Rice (RM13.80).
The Chicken Chop was a fried piece of chicken doused with a brown sauce that came with lots of peas and even more fries. While it did look visually appealing, I found the chicken meat to be dry and rubbery. It felt like it had been over-cooked. The seasoning was good but let down by the over zealous frying.

Thankfully, the Chicken Rice at Choon Guan Hainan Coffee 1956 was excellent. The rice was firm and fragrant. Every grain, clearly separated from each other. They use kampung chicken to make the chicken rice. The chicken was tender & full of flavour. Looking at the picture, you can still see the moisture in it. It made the drive to Port Klang worth it.

PSA - Parking is limited in this area as the coffee shop is located directly opposite the market. So pick your times to come here. I figure that mornings on weekends are going to be bad.
